MMP Consultancy is recruiting a Leasehold Officer for a temporary position in North London. The successful candidate will handle various responsibilities, including managing charges for leasehold flats, offering advice to those in hardship, and assisting with consultations involving leaseholders.
Excellent communication, prioritization, and IT skills are essential. This role requires strong initiative and the ability to perform data analysis effectively. This is an exciting opportunity for those looking to make a significant impact in property management.
